So how did the Planning Commission public hearing for Hillside Cottages (68th & Carr) get rescheduled to election day? And don't they open Council chambers for people to watch election results? Here's what happened...and how it affects us.
Three out of seven of the commissioners were unable to attend the originally scheduled meeting. Technically, four commissioners is enough to hold the meeting, but a motion to approve or to deny would have required unanimity in order to pass.
When this situation occurs, the City gives the applicant (developer) the option to postpone the meeting. The developer chose to postpone. The Planning Commission meets every other Tuesday, and the next possible meeting date was Tue, Nov. 8th, election day.
Normally, the Planning Commission does not meet on election day. But in order to keep this development on the City Council schedule for Nov. 21st, the Planning Commission agreed to meet on election day.
In some election years, when a City Council seat is up for election, City Hall opens Council chambers for the public to watch election results. This year, no Council seats are up for re-election, so Council chambers will not be open for watching election results, according to Joanie Brown, Administrative Supervisor of Planning and Zoning.
So, Hillside Cottages is the only item on the agenda for Nov. 8th, and Council chambers will be dedicated to that purpose.
With no other business on the agenda that night and the room reserved for this hearing, time will be available for members of the public to present their perspectives without the urgency of other cases needing to be heard afterward, and without confusion over who's there for which purpose.
We're still expecting only five of the seven commissioners on Nov. 8th. What that means in terms of votes needed will be in the next update.
